The EB-2 NIW (National Interest Waiver) visa requires applicants to demonstrate, among other criteria, that their research has a significant impact, including the potential to save lives. Therefore, proving this relevance is a key point to strengthen the petition before the United States immigration authorities. One way to evidence this potential is by presenting recent and impactful publications that describe the results of your research, showing how it can contribute to innovations or significant improvements in the healthcare field. Articles in scientific journals, presentations at conferences, and independent reviews can be excellent examples of the recognition your research has already received.
In addition, certificates of approval from ethics committees or funding agencies that support the development of technologies benefiting treatments or diagnostics already reinforce the importance of your work. Another consistent strategy is to include recommendation or support letters from recognized experts and institutions in the field, who can attest to the potential of your research to save lives. These testimonials, from renowned professionals, help demonstrate the credibility and practical impact of your studies.
Whenever possible, include data from preliminary results, clinical studies, or statistics that point to an effective and safe application in improving medical treatments. It is equally important to disclose information about partnerships with healthcare institutions or research centers that are already implementing, or have plans to implement, your technology or scientific discovery. Detailing these links can help prove the commitment of the medical and scientific community to your innovative idea, showing that your work is not just theoretical but on the path to practical application with direct benefits for the population.
